| Moose 2008-09-03 16:24:21 Survey |
Harker Research is a full service market research firm serving the media industry across the US, Canada and Europe. The company provides a broad range of perceptual research services, including Strategic Market Studies, Auditorium Music Tests, Call-Out Music Evaluation, Focus Groups and Sales Effectiveness Studies on a market exclusive basis.

| mel 2007-09-06 23:35:27 Telemarketer |
This research company had called me before and would ask me about what radio stations I listened to, and then asked if I would be willing to listen to some snippets of current songs and say whether I had heard them, if I liked them, and if I thought they were being played on the radio too much.
They'd call every 3 weeks or so, maybe every month, always thanking me for my time (10 or 15 minutes each call) and letting me know if I wasn't ever able to do it, let them know.
I did. 4 times. They won't stop calling. Now, our caller ID box is full, with about 85% of the calls being from this one company.
